web前端前面空两格怎么办

不及物动词 其他 118

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    如果在web前端开发过程中,前面出现了空两格的情况,可以采取以下几种方法来解决:

    1. 使用CSS的margin属性:可以给需要调整的元素添加margin属性,设置左边距为两个空格的宽度。例如,要调整一个div元素的左边距为两个空格的宽度,可以使用如下的CSS样式:
    div {
      margin-left: 2em; /*em是相对于父元素字体大小的单位*/
    }
    
    1. 使用CSS的padding属性: 如果需要调整的是元素的内部内容的缩进,可以使用padding属性。例如,要调整一个段落的内部内容缩进两个空格的宽度,可以使用如下CSS样式:
    p {
      padding-left: 2em;
    }
    
    1. 使用CSS的text-indent属性: 如果只是需要调整文字的缩进,可以使用text-indent属性。例如,要将一个段落的文字缩进两个空格的宽度,可以使用如下CSS样式:
    p {
      text-indent: 2em;
    }
    

    以上几种方法可以根据具体情况选择适合的方式来解决空两格的问题。在前端开发中,灵活运用CSS属性可以实现各种页面布局、样式调整的需求。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    如果在Web前端开发中,出现了前面空两格的问题,可以通过以下方法进行处理:

    1. 使用CSS的margin属性调整间距:可以在HTML标签或CSS样式中使用margin属性来调整元素之间的间距。可以通过设置左外边距(margin-left)为两个空格的宽度来实现前面空两格的效果。例如:

      .element {
         margin-left: 2em; /* 2个空格的宽度 */
      }
      
    2. 使用padding属性调整内部的空格:如果是在元素的内部需要前面空两格的效果,可以使用CSS的padding属性来调整内部的空格。通过设置左内边距(padding-left)为两个空格的宽度,可以实现前面空两格的效果。例如:

      .element {
         padding-left: 2em; /* 2个空格的宽度 */
      }
      
    3. 使用非断行空格(non-breaking space):非断行空格( )是HTML实体,可以用来创建一个空格字符,不会被浏览器忽略。可以在需要前面空两格的位置使用 来实现。例如:

      <p>&nbsp;&nbsp;这里是前面空两格的文本</p>
      
    4. 使用pre标签:pre标签是HTML中的一个元素,用来表示预格式化文本,保留原始空格和换行符。可以将需要前面空两格的文本包裹在pre标签中,实现前面空两格的效果。例如:

      <pre>  这里是前面空两格的文本</pre>
      
    5. 使用CSS的text-indent属性:可以使用text-indent属性来设置段落的首行缩进。可以将text-indent设置为两个空格的宽度来实现前面空两格的效果。例如:

      .element {
         text-indent: 2em; /* 2个空格的宽度 */
      }
      

    通过以上方法,可以实现在Web前端开发中需要前面空两格的效果。选择适合场景的方法,根据具体情况进行调整和应用。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    问题:web前端前面空两格怎么办?

    回答:

    在Web前端开发中,空格的处理是非常重要的,因为空格可以影响页面的布局和显示效果。如果在前端中出现了需要在前面空两格的情况,可以通过以下几种方法来实现:

    1. 使用HTML实体编码
      在HTML中,有一些特殊字符需要使用实体编码来表示,空格也是其中之一。可以使用&nbsp;来表示一个空格。在需要显示两个空格的地方,可以使用&nbsp;&nbsp;来表示。

    2. 使用CSS的text-indent属性
      CSS中的text-indent属性可以设置文本块的首行缩进。可以通过设置text-indent: 2em;来实现在文本块前面空两个字的效果。注意,这里的em是一个相对单位,具体的空格大小可以根据实际需求进行调整。

    3. 使用CSS的伪元素
      可以使用CSS的伪元素来在文本前面添加内容,从而实现空格的效果。可以使用::before伪元素来添加一个空格字符或其他内容。

    4. 使用内联样式
      在特定情况下,可以直接在HTML标签中使用style属性来设置样式,例如<span style="margin-left: 2em;">文本块</span>,将margin-left属性设置为2em来实现首行缩进的效果。

    5. 使用JavaScript处理
      如果需要在动态生成的内容中添加空格,可以使用JavaScript来处理。可以使用字符串的相关方法,如padStart(),将空格字符添加到字符串的前面。

    请根据实际情况选择合适的方法来处理在前端中前面空两个字的需求。以上是几种常见的方法,希望能对你有所帮助。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部